Those of you are staying in Grundy are once again welcome to drive up on Friday
evening and do some birding around the place. We usually have a few people who
do that each year. We then drive back down to Grundy to have an evening meal at
a local restaurant. If there is not a football game at the Grundy High School,
we drive by there at dusk to watch the hundreds of Chimney Swifts go into the
chimney to roost.
